§ 25-6-201 — This part 2 to be liberally construed

Text
This part 2 shall be liberally
construed to protect the rights of all individuals to pursue their religious beliefs, to
follow the dictates of their own consciences, to prevent the imposition upon any
individual of practices offensive to the individual's moral standards, to respect the
right of every individual to self-determination in the procreation of children, and to
ensure a complete freedom of choice in pursuance of constitutional rights.

Legislative History
Source: L. 65: p. 464, � 1. C.R.S. 1963: � 36-20-7.
